Anita Ann Gostomczik

January 29, 1932 — October 10, 2018

Anita Ann Gostomczik, age 86, of Waseca, died peacefully on Wednesday, October 10, 2018, at St. Marys Hospital in Rochester.

Mass of Christian Burial will be 11:30 AM on Tuesday, October 16, 2018, at Church of the Sacred Heart in Waseca with Fr. Gregory Leif as Celebrant. Interment will follow in Calvary Cemetery.

Visitation will be from 4-8 PM on Monday, October 15, 2018 at Starkson & Steffel Funeral & Cremation Service ~ McRaith Chapel of Waseca. Visitation will continue for one hour prior to the Mass at church on Tuesday.

Anita Ann was born on January 29, 1932 to Charles and Eva (Frederick) Hoehn in Madison Lake. Anita was baptized as an infant and later confirmed her Catholic faith all at All Saints Catholic Church in Madison Lake. Anita received her education at Mankato Public Schools, graduating with the class of 1950. Shortly after her graduation she was united in marriage to Joseph Gostomczik on October 17, 1950, at All Saints Catholic Church in Madison Lake. Together, they moved to a farm in rural Waseca where they started a family. Together they had four children and shared 43 years of marriage before Joe passed away on April 2, 1994.

Anita worked full time as a secretary at Donahue Real Estate and later as a cook at the Waseca Hospital. Although she held a full time job, her first priority was raising her family. She was a great farm wife, helping out where ever she was needed and she was a great mother to her four children. Later in life she worked for Quad County and was the Blooming Grove Township Board Supervisor for 37 years. Anita was a faithful member of Sacred Heart Catholic Church in Waseca. Anita was an avid gardener and would frequently bring her produce to the Waseca Farmers Market. In her younger years Anita and Joe would frequently go square dancing and play cards any chance they could. They raised Collies for many years. Anita was a huge Vikings fan. She loved fishing and visiting with friends. Above all else, she cherished the time she spent with her children, grandchildren, and great grandchildren.

Anita is survived by her children: Joseph "Chuck" Gostomczik of Janesville, Shari (Mike) Heinen of Hutchinson, Connie (Larry) Troy of Owatonna, and Kathy (Brad) Wallace of Gaylord; 12 grandchildren; 20 great grandchildren; brother, Joseph (Carol) Hoehn of Shakopee; sisters-in-law: Marce Williams of Madison, WI and Merle Gostomczik of Medford; many nieces, nephews, other relatives and friends.

She was preceded in death by her parents, husband, granddaughter, MaryJo Wallace, three brothers and one sister.
